+What:		/config/usb-gadget/gadget/functions/rndis.name
+Date:		May 2013
+KenelVersion:	3.11
+Description:
+		The attributes:
+
+		ifname		- network device interface name associated with
+				this function instance
+		qmult		- queue length multiplier for high and
+				super speed
+		host_addr	- MAC address of host's end of this
+				Ethernet over USB link
+		dev_addr	- MAC address of device's end of this
+				Ethernet over USB link

+config USB_CONFIGFS_RNDIS
+	bool "RNDIS"
+	depends on USB_CONFIGFS
+	depends on NET
+	select USB_U_ETHER
+	select USB_F_RNDIS
+	help
+	   Microsoft Windows XP bundles the "Remote NDIS" (RNDIS) protocol,
+	   and Microsoft provides redistributable binary RNDIS drivers for
+	   older versions of Windows.
+
+	   To make MS-Windows work with this, use Documentation/usb/linux.inf
+	   as the "driver info file".  For versions of MS-Windows older than
+	   XP, you'll need to download drivers from Microsoft's website; a URL
+	   is given in comments found in that info file.
